JCSO says they’re close to making arrest in Stephanie Warner’s disappearance

Ruch, Ore. — The Jackson County Sheriff’s Office believes it is closer than ever to making an arrest in a missing woman’s case.

Stephanie Warner from Ruch was last seen walking in the 2013 Ashland 4th of July parade.

Detective Eric Henderson says he has received dozens of new tips in this case ever since our story aired last week.

Most of the tips focus on Lennie Ames, Warner’s boyfriend.

Detective Henderson then named Ames as the only suspect in the case.

He was the last person to see warner back in 2013 and now Henderson says he is in Georgia.

The Jackson County Sheriff’s office is not going to be going to Georgia in the event that a warrant is issued for Lennie Ames arrest in this case, theres law enforcement agencies out there that actually will be utilized to find him.”

Henderson says they are still putting together crucial pieces in this case and cannot go get Ames until they have a warrant for his arrest.

The latest information has also captured the attention of Dateline’s “Missing in America.”
